India’s BSE Sensex closed about 0.2% lower at 81,451 on Friday, snapping the previous day’s gains, amid a risk-averse mood fueled by ongoing market volatility and global trade uncertainties. On Thursday, a federal appeals court temporarily allowed US President Donald Trump to reinstate tariffs, reversing a recent trade court ruling that had blocked them. Several sectors struggled, particularly tech, autos, and pharma, which were some of the worst hit. Meanwhile, market participants turned their focus to India’s GDP figures and the US PCE price index data. Among individual stocks, HCL Tech, Tech Mahindra, Infosys, Asian Paints, NTPC, Sun Pharma, Mahindra & Mahindra, and Tata Consultancy Services were the biggest laggards, with losses ranging between 1% and 2%. Conversely, shares of Eternal, soared over 4%, mainly due to bargain hunting after recent sharp declines. The Sensex extended its losses into a second consecutive week, declining 0.3%, but recorded a third monthly gain of 1.5%.
